Pound
The pound (lb) is a unit of mass equal to exactly 0.45359237 kilogram.
From Latin 'libra pondo' (a pound by weight); the symbol lb comes from 'libra'.
The primary weight unit in the United States and informally in the UK.
The international avoirdupois pound was fixed in the 1959 yard-and-pound agreement.
Sun's Mass
The solar mass (M(S)) is about 2.0E30 kg.
The standard unit for expressing stellar and galactic masses.
Astrophysics and cosmology.
Established as astronomers measured the Sun's gravitational influence.
Pound to Sun's Mass conversion formula
Note: this conversion uses a generally accepted modern value. Historical and regional definitions of this unit varied across times and places.
The relationship between pounds and sun's mass:
To convert pounds to sun's mass, multiply the value in pounds by 2.267962e-31. To reverse, multiply sun's mass by 4.409245e+30.
